A typical project begins with a free on-site assessment to discuss your goals, budget, and access. We then prepare a clear plan with phased tasks, from initial tidying and soil preparation to planting, lawn care, and edging. Throughout, we prioritise safety--carrying out risk assessments, coordinating with you on access times, and minimising disruption to your daily routine. After completion, we provide a walkthrough, share before-and-after photos, and offer maintenance options to help you sustain the results. We're happy to tailor the plan to include eco-friendly materials or drought-tolerant plant choices.

Locally, residents can recycle garden waste through the Broxbourne Borough Council green waste service and the council recycling centre network. We routinely advise clients on the best options for composting clippings, branches, and leaves, and we can help you plan a local drop-off or curbside service schedule. If you're unsure, we'll point you to the nearest facility, help you understand what is accepted, and outline how to flatten and bag materials for easy handling, while explaining any costs or seasonal limits. We also encourage mulching where appropriate to reduce waste.
